Beat ‘Em Up
Get ready to experience the ultimate rush of adrenaline as you dive into the world of Beat ‘Em Up, a 3D game that combines the best of boxing and karate. Developed by Pokid, this action-packed game is designed to challenge your reflexes and strategic thinking.
With intuitive controls, you'll be able to navigate the game with ease, using a combination of punches, kicks, and special moves to take down your opponents. But that's not all – you'll also need to use your wits to outmaneuver your foes and avoid taking damage.
To succeed in Beat ‘Em Up, you'll need to use your strategy and quick thinking to outmaneuver your opponents. Here are a few tips to get you started:
Pay attention to your opponent's movements and patterns, and use this knowledge to anticipate their next move.
Use your special moves wisely, as they can be a game-changer in intense battles.
Keep an eye on your health bars and try to conserve your energy for critical moments.
